Cuttack: Carcass of a female elephant calf was recovered at Paikerapur under Khuntuni range in Athagarh of Cuttack district on Wednesday.
The incident came to the light after some locals spotted the carcass at the backyard of a villager’s house and informed forest officials.
Forest officials and police have seized the body for autopsy. They suspect that the calf died due to electrocution.
In a separate incident, a youth suffered grievous injuries after being attacked by a crocodile in Patasala river at Rajnagar in Kendrapara district. He was rushed to a nearby hospital for treatment.
The victim had gone out of his house to answer nature’s call when the incident took place.
